Crockpot corned beef and cabbage is the easiest way to cook a corned beef. After tossing everything in the crockpot and letting the corned beef and cabbage cook you end up with the most amazing, tender and delicious corned beef and cabbage ever.
Prep your crockpot by spraying non stick cooking spray or lining it with a disposable crockpot liner and setting the temperature setting to high.
Place your corned beef in the crockpot, pour the seasoning packet that comes with it on top of the meat then pour enough water to cover the whole corned beef.
Put the lid on the crockpot to start cooking on high for 8.5 hours.
After 3 hours of cooking, if you are adding carrots and/or potatoes you will want to add them to the crockpot so they can cook with the corned beef.
At the 7 hour mark rinse your cabbage and cut it into wedges. Add the cabbage wedges into the crockpot.
Cook the corned beef and veggies for another hour. At the 8 hour mark check the corned beef and the cabbage to see if it is cooked all the way. You also want to make sure the vegetables are tender.
If the beef is not fully cooked and the veggies are still a bit hard, continue cooking for another 30 minutes.
Once it is done cooking remove the beef from the crockpot and allow to cool and set for 5 minutes before cutting.
Once the corned beef is completely cooled and set, slice corned beef into slices.
Remove the veggies in place them in a serving bowl.
